Average package of Rs 22.67 lakh for top 20% students of IIM Shillong

Median package was Rs 16.5 lakh, with maximum offers being made by Cognizant, Deloitte USI, ICICI Bank, JP Morgan & Chase and TATA Steel.

The final placements of the 10th batch of IIM Shillong concluded recently, with the highest package of Rs 28 lakh and average package of Rs 16.79 lakh being offered to the 177 participants. This is an increase of 8.3 per cent from 2016-17. While the median package was Rs 16.5 lakh, the average package for the top 20 per cent and top 50 per cent of the batch was Rs 22.67 lakh and Rs 19.75 lakh respectively.

About 662 companies participated in the placement drive, with the consulting and strategy domains emerging as the most preferred. In fact, these domains made up more than 26 per cent of the total jobs offered to the students and also offered the highest package, with an average CTC of Rs 17.96 lakh. The highest number of job offers came from Cognizant, Deloitte USI, ICICI Bank, JP Morgan & Chase and TATA Steel.

The companies who participated included first time participants, such as Vedanta, Xiaomi, Bain Capability Network, Bajaj Finserv, Basix Sub-K, Carwale, eClerx, EY, Essar Group, Freudenberg, GMM Pfaudler, HDFC Bank, Henkel, Landmark Group (Splash), Markets & Markets, Maruti Suzuki, Ola Cabs, OYO, TAFE, Tredence, Trident, Ultratech Cement and TATA Power. The major names amongst the regulars were Accenture, Amazon, Cognizant, Deloitte USI, GroupM, ICICI Bank, Infosys, JP Morgan & Chase, Nomura Investment Bank, Northern Arc, RBL Bank, ShopClues, Stellium Consulting, TATA Motors, TATA Steel, Ujjivan Small Finance Bank, ValueLabs and VMWare.

The roles offered to students range from advisory, analytics, change management, consulting, corporate strategy, and investment banking to retail management, sales & marketing, strategy & operations and supply chain management.
